Phase one replaces points accrual with tiered status, simplifying redemption and cutting administrative load in the Fenwick Cross service centre. Phase two introduces partner benefits through Tallow & Finch retail sites. Customer communications begin next month; frontline scripts are being drafted by Soren Albeck's team. Expect migration queries to spike for roughly six weeks. Budget figures are unchanged. The commercially sensitive element of this overhaul is recorded below.

internal memo for hahif-hahaf: Headcount on the Zorwyn team goes from 9 to 100 by the end of October. Gross margin on Zorwyn came in at 5 percent against a plan of 10 percent.

Subject: DR drill — queue-depth autoscaler

Team,

Drill for the Fennwick autoscaler runs Thursday. We will kill the primary scaler in the Orvale region and confirm the standby picks up queue-depth metrics within 90 seconds. If failover stalls, restart the scaler with the sealed recovery profile. Do not tune thresholds mid-drill; log everything to the drill channel instead. The sealed profile unlocks only with the passphrase below.

vault phrase of bagaf-kajeg = jorath-feniel-briir-siliel-ralix

Handing off the Quillbus broker upgrade (4.x to 5.1) to Dario. Cluster is half-migrated; mixed-version mode is supported but TLS cert rotation must finish before cutover. No auth model changes, though the admin API gained two new endpoints worth reviewing. Open questions and the migration checklist are tracked on the internal page below.

dashboard of taduf-bawef = https://jira.lumicsys.internal/projects/display/browse/b1cbf89d

Canary deploys on Driftlane follow strict gating. New builds go to 5% of traffic for 30 minutes. Gate fails if error rate exceeds 0.5% or p95 latency rises 20% over baseline. Failed gates auto-rollback; no manual override without a lead's sign-off. Metrics come from the Pinemetric collector. The gate evaluator runs as a sidecar and authenticates to Pinemetric with a token from its env file. That token is set on the line just below this one:

sealed setting: COURIER_KEY29=170ad45524657711572101e080d15